Natural Products
Catalog No. Information
CFN99190 Caffeic acid

Caffeic acid has antidiabetic, antioxidant, anticarcinogenic, and anti-inflammatory activities, it can suppress ultraviolet B(UVB)-induced COX-2 expression by blocking Fyn kinase activity, inhibits HBV-DNA replication as well as HBsAg production, also reduces serum DHBV level in DHBV-infected duckling model. Caffeic acid may be used as designed novel therapeutic drugs for Parkinson's disease by inhibiting α-synuclein fibrillation.
CFN99116 Chlorogenic acid

Chlorogenic acid, a phenolic compound found ubiquitously in plants, is an antioxidant and metal chelator, it has antiviral activity by inhibiting HBV replication, it inhibits the inflammatory reaction in HSE via the suppression of TLR2/TLR9-Myd88 signaling pathways. Some derivatives of chlorogenic acid are hypoglycemic agents and may affect lipid metabolism, chlorogenic acid can improve glucose tolerance, decrease some plasma and liver lipids, and improve mineral pool distribution in vivo.
CFN99074 Taraxasterol

Taraxasterol has anti-inflammatory, anti- tumor-promoting , anti-endotoxic shock and anti-allergic asthma activities. It inhibited NO, IFN-γ, PGE(2), TNF-α, IL-1β and IL-6 production.
CFN99381 Taraxerol

Taraxerol can be used as a lipid biomarker for mangrove input to the SE Atlantic. Taraxerol has potent anti-inflammatory effects,it downregulates the expression of proinflammatory mediators in macrophages by interfering with the activation of TAK1 and Akt, thus preventing NF-κB activation. Taraxerol also has anti-cancer activity, it shows inhibitory effects on AGS cell growth through inducing G2/M arrest and promotion of cell apoptosis, taraxeryl acetate has less effect on cell cycle arrest and apoptosis of AGS cells than taraxerol.
CFN98935 beta-Amyrin

beta-Amyrin has antiviral, hepatoprotective, antinociceptive, anti-inflammatory, it retard acute inflammation in rat model of periodontitis. Beta-Amyrin can enhance the total sleeping behavior in pentobarbital-induced sleeping model via the activation of GABAergic neurotransmitter system through GABA content in the brain.alpha- and beta-Amyrin mixture has gastro-protective activity, the mechanism involves at least in part the activation of capsaicin-sensitive primary afferent neurons; it also has sedative and anxiolytic effects, the mechanism may involve an action on benzodiazepine-type receptors, and also an antidepressant effect where noradrenergic mechanisms will probably play a role.
CFN98821 Taraxerone

Taraxerone has allelopathic and antifungal effects.Taraxerone prevents catalase, superoxide dismutase, and reduces glutathione concentrations from the decrease induced by ethanol administration with the concentration dependent manner.
CFN98689 Pseudotaraxasterol

Pseudotaraxasterol shows cytotoxic activity against MOLT-4 cells.
CFN98087 Taraxeryl acetate

Taraxeryl acetate shows the significant antiviral activity against herpes simplex virus (type II). It has less effect on cell cycle arrest and apoptosis of AGS cells than taraxerol. A. roxburghiana has antidiabetic activity, could be attributed due to PTP1B inhibition by its triterpene constituents, betulin, betulinic acid and Taraxeryl acetate.
CFN97789 Epitaraxerol

Epitaraxerol shows moderate antifungal activity against C. albicans and low antimicrobial activity against T. mentagrophytes, A. niger, S. aureus, E. coli, P. aeruginosa, and B. subtilis.
